When R. Allen Stanford's financial empire collapsed, the reverberations spread throughout the world. There is now a receiver in just about every country where the Texan operated, and all are assigned to track down what's left of Houston-based Stanford Financial Group and its related enterprises. "This thing has gotten so many hydra-like heads," said one lawyer who represents Stanford clients, adding, "This is going to be very complicated, probably more complicated than the Madoff receivership."3rd DCA rules on case of confidential email sent inadvertently to wrong attorney
